Mannes College The New School for Music
Tenure Track Position in Music Theory to begin Fall, 2008

Mannes, a division of The New School, announces a search to fill the newly created Edward Aldwell Professorship in The Techniques of Music.  The successful candidate will be a musician of depth and accomplishment (with a record of significant publications or comparable professional achievement) who is experienced in and dedicated to teaching Schenkerian music theory and analysis at the college level, and who will participate in implementation and long-range development of the Techniques of Music curriculum at Mannes.  Proficiency in Schenkerian theory and analysis and experience in teaching intensive courses to develop the abilities of performance students to do analyses on their own is essential.  The Edward Aldwell Professor will be willing to work within the established Mannes curriculum and participate in the development of that curriculum over time, will have leadership potential, and will participate in ongoing discussions and decisions about the relation of the conserv
 atory
 curriculum to the broader curricular concerns of the university as a whole.  Additional areas of specialization and teaching ability that may enhance candidates' applications include:  20th-century music history and/or analysis; advanced ear training, keyboard harmony, and score reading; composition; music history; or performance). 

Qualifications: An earned doctoral degree in music theory, completed by the time of application, or a record of comparable achievement, as well as at least five years teaching music theory and related topics at the college level, and an appropriate record of professional accomplishment (refereed publications or comparable achievement in composition or performance).  Candidates who are ABD at the time they apply will not be considered.  Salary competitive based on experience.  Rank open.  Tenure track or Extended-employment track.  A final candidate currently holding tenure may be considered for tenure upon appointment.  Comprehensive benefits package.
